PyTorch Geometric (PyG)

Allows to easily implement graph neural networks in a PyTorch fashion. See this example taken from a talk of the creator of PyG (Twitter: @rusty1s) implementing a convolutional graph neural network and compare it with the example in the PyTorch section.

from torch_geometric.nn import GCNConv

class GNN(torch.nn.Module):
  def __init__(self):
    self.conv1 = GCNConv(3, 64)
    self.conv2 = GCNConv(64, 64)

    def forward(self, input, edge_index):
      h = self.conv1(input, edge_index)
      h = h.relu()
      h = self.conv2(h, edge_index)
      return h

Captum

Library built on PyTorch for interpretability research. Allows to better debug deep learning models and implements methods such as integrated gradients.

BackPACK

Library built on top of PyTorch to extract more information from backpropagation to compute approximations of the Hessian or variance of the gradients to implement higher order optimization schemes. https://backpack.pt/
